Carrollton Turf Conditions

Carrollton sits on some seriously heavy red clay—the kind that holds water and turns into a slippery mess during rainy spells. This is exactly why artificial turf sport courts thrive here. We factor that clay base into every install, making sure your sub-base and drainage system work *with* the local soil, not against it. Most lots in the UWG neighborhoods and Downtown Carrollton run modest acreage, so we're experts at maximizing playable court space without eating up your whole yard. Sun exposure varies wildly depending on tree coverage from the Greenbelt area or mature oaks in older residential sections—our crew scouts your property to ensure proper orientation and understands which microclimates get brutal afternoon heat. Georgia's humidity means regular turf gets stressed and weedy; synthetic turf laughs at it. We also account for Carroll County's seasonal rainfall patterns, designing slopes and perimeter drainage that prevent standing water. Your court will be ready to play on 24 hours after a storm, which beats waiting three days for natural grass to dry out.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do you deal with Carrollton's red clay when installing a sport court?

We excavate the clay to proper depth, then install a compacted limestone and gravel base layer that provides drainage and stability. The red clay actually works in our favor—it's dense enough to support a solid foundation. We've done this hundreds of times across Carroll County. Your court sits on a engineered base, not loose clay, so you get zero settling or divots after a season of play.

Will a sport court work on a small lot near UWG?

Absolutely. Most college-town properties in Carrollton run tight on acreage, but we design courts to fit. A standard basketball or tennis court doesn't need a massive footprint. We'll work with your existing landscape and HOA guidelines to place the court where it gets sun, drains well, and doesn't cramp your living space. We've built plenty on modest lots around the UWG area.

How often do I need to maintain the turf during Georgia summers?

Almost never. No mowing, no watering, no fertilizer. Occasional light brushing and rinsing to clear debris is it. Carroll County's summer heat and humidity would beat natural grass into submission—artificial turf laughs at it. You'll spend more time playing on your court than maintaining it.

Does Carrollton's humid climate cause mold or algae on synthetic turf?

High-quality sports turf is designed to shed moisture and dry quickly, even in Georgia's humidity. We use premium drainage and antimicrobial backing. Years of installations in Carroll County show no mold issues. The key is proper base prep and choosing the right turf—both things we handle.
